Next-Gen Hydroponics in Modern Gardens: Tech Prowess and Resourcefulness
The sphere of gardening is undergoing a significant transformation thanks to the rise of hydroponic systems. These innovative techniques allow for cultivation of plants without soil, utilizing nutrient-rich water solutions and precise environmental regulation. Hydroponics offers a abundance of benefits for modern gardeners, including boosted yields, decreased water consumption, and the possibility to grow year-round, regardless of external conditions.
Modern hydroponic systems often incorporate a variety of technologies, such as automated watering mechanisms, LED fixtures, and sensors that monitor crucial factors like pH levels and nutrient concentrations. These technological developments not only streamline the gardening process but also facilitate greater control over plant growth, resulting in healthier crops.
- Additionally, hydroponics allows gardeners to cultivate a wider range of plants, including vegetables, in compact spaces. This makes it an excellent solution for urban dwellers or those with confined gardening areas.
- As a result, hydroponic systems are becoming increasingly prevalent among both hobbyists and professional growers who seek to enhance their production while minimizing their environmental footprint.
